Skip to content

Update links on info page#11590

Merged
bramkragten merged 1 commit intodevfrom
update-links-info
Feb 7, 2022
Merged

Update links on info page#11590
bramkragten merged 1 commit intodevfrom
update-links-info

Commits

Commits on May 20, 2021